Three luxury fibers are expertly blended into one perfect yarn. The merino adds softness and bounce, the alpaca adds luster and drape and the 15% yak adds warmth and a bit of mystery to this luxury yarn. This classic worsted weight has a generous amount of yardage for a 50g ball. What does this mean? Surprisingly light weight projects that work up quickly and don't take a huge bite out of your wallet!

Yarn Weight
4 Medium / Worsted
Crochet Gauge (4in x 4in)
16 S x 17 R on H-8 (5 mm)
Knit Gauge (4in x 4in)
18 S x 24 R on #7 (4.5 mm)
Length (yd)
126
Length (m)
115
Weight (oz)
1.75
Weight (g)
50
Fiber
Alpaca, Merino Wool, Yak
Fiber Detail
70% Merino, 15% Alpaca, 15% Yak
Care
Hand Wash, Lay Flat to Dry

Lovely, light and luxurious yarn

The merino, yak and alpaca blend drew me in and that combined with the lovely, soft colors made me buy it. Well-spun and wonderfully consistent in the hand, it knits to a lovely, soft, light-feeling fabric with loft. I am using it to make the Emory Toque from the free pattern on the website. Designated a #4 worsted weight yarn, I am using a US number 8 needle (5 mm) and the results look just right. A beautiful yarn I will purchase again, and I look forward to re-purchasing the oatmeal color (which was sold out when I went to buy more) but all the colors are delightful. This yarn would be good for accessories like the hat I am making but also would make a beautiful sweater. Ample yardage makes the price well-worth it.

Good yarn but not medium weight

I like this yarn but it should be listed as a light DK or sport weight. I'm a tight knitter but had to go down two needle sizes (from an 8 to a 6) to get my project to show good cable definition and not look lacy. The yarn is very soft and I'd buy it again, but only for a sport weight project.
